Vieillissement cutané -- PréventionIndex. décimale : 668.5 Parfums et cosmétiques Résumé : The many environmental factors related to modem lifestyle generate a skin imbalance that leads to premature ageing. In this study, we evaluate the capacity of a new skin delivery system based on bicosomes (named bicosome-xanthin) to provide intense detox and revert the signs of ageing. This system was specially designed to incorporate, stabilise and deliver microalgae extract into deep skin layers. Bicosome¬xanthin proved to be effective in protecting the skin against pollution particles and to prevent 90% of the damage caused by blue light. This extraordinary ingredient also proved in vivo to boost the skin's antioxidant capacity and barrier function, to accelerate epidermal cell renewal, improve skin brightness and firmness, and visibly reduce wrinkles. TélomèresUn télomère est une région hautement répétitive, donc non codante, d'ADN à l'extrémité d'un chromosome. À chaque fois qu'un chromosome en bâtonnet d'un eucaryote est dupliqué, lors de la réplication, qui précède la mitose (division cellulaire), le complexe enzymatique de l'ADN polymérase s'avère incapable de copier les derniers nucléotides : l'absence de télomère signifierait la perte rapide d'informations génétiques nécessaires au fonctionnement cellulaire.
Les télomères raccourcissent avec l’âge, l’inflammation et le stress. Des études ont montré que des télomères courts sont associés à un risque plus élevé de maladies liées à l’âge.
Vieillissement cutanéIndex. décimale : 668.5 Parfums et cosmétiques Résumé : There remain challenges and opportunities to improve the ageing skin as I hope this article has emphasised. I would summarise the achievable goals for non-prescription products as wrinkle reduction, reduction of sebaceous pore diameter, skin smoothing, skin textural improvement of dyspigmentation.
Daily use of effective photoprotective products have been clearly shown to reduce accelerated skin ageing as well as skin cancers and pre-skin cancers.
There are goals that I consider unrealistic and include claims for nonprescription products being able to lift faces, lift and enlarge busts, firm and lift buttocks, cure cellulite, and get rid of enlarged veins and telangiectasia.
At present the technology is not available in my opnion to achieve these goals.

Peau -- Soins et hygièneIndex. décimale : 668.5 Parfums et cosmétiques Résumé : As we are living in a world full of uncertainties, where we are challenged by the coming together of environmental, health and employment crises, mental and physical stresses tend to overwhelm us. These stresses have deleterious effects on human body and especially on skin. They lead to the impairment of cell bioenergetic functions, thus contributing to premature skin aging. To recover serenity, being inspired by Japanese traditions and their Zen aesthetic principles can be a new way to address daily stresses. This paper presents the concept of Zen aesthetics that allowed us to develop several formulations under the beauty concept called “Zenspiration”. Among these formulations, the Energizing Water Cream is dedicated to re-energizing stressed cells. This paper also describes the skin biological benefits provided by an active ingredient called Rootness™ Energize, included in the Energizing Water Cream, and developed thanks to the plant milking technology. This extract from the roots of Luffa cylindrica demonstrated in vitro its ability to protect and stimulate cell bioenergetic functions while stimulating antioxidant defense systems and accelerating the renewal of key extracellular matrix components. A clinical study enrolling stressed women demonstrated that Rootness™ Energize improved skin elasticity and firmness in stressed women, leading to a reduction in wrinkles.
